Step 2: FD leak isolation

Before bisecting, run the Murkwell ingest daemon with descriptor auditing enabled so the leak hunter can attribute each open handle. Keep soft limits low to force failures early; reviewers should confirm the audit ring buffer is large enough. Launch the daemon with these values.

config for kafof-bawef:
holath:
  log_level: debug
  metrics_host: metrics.holath.qorvelsys.internal
  pin: 2191
  pool_size: 32

Q: My plugin lost access to the RendGrid transcoding farm sandbox. How do I recover?

A: Sandbox accounts can't be reset by support. Use the recovery terminal: stop your worker, launch with the --recover flag, and wait for the prompt. One attempt per launch. For approved plugin authors, the shared sandbox recovery passphrase is listed below.

strongbox words: norwyn-wenael-aldvan-aldiel-wendor-holael

## Configuration

The Murmurstone audio-guide app reads its settings from a local .env file at startup. Most defaults are fine for development against the Tallowfield Museum staging catalog. The one required entry is the stream-access credential, without which exhibit narration will not load. Add it to .env on its own line like so:

env line for fafof-fahag: LEDGER_TOKEN5=f8790

## Snapshot Testing Quickstart

Welcome, plugin folks! Every Lumabits UI component ships with snapshot tests — run `luma test --snap` and compare against the stored baselines. If your plugin changes rendering, regenerate snapshots and commit them. Baselines are versioned in the metadata database rather than the repo, so first connect to it using the string below.

replica DSN, kajep-yahag: mssql://praok_svc:iF@db-8d68.plorvaio.local:5432/eliion